Article Biochemistry & Molecular Biology

Anti-Inflammatory Effects of 6-Methylcoumarin in LPS-Stimulated RAW 264.7 Macrophages via Regulation of MAPK and NF-κB Signaling Pathways

Jin-Kyu Kang et al.

Summary: The study demonstrated that 6-MC reduced the levels of nitric oxide and prostaglandin E-2 without causing cytotoxicity, and also decreased the expression of pro-inflammatory cytokines in a concentration-dependent manner in LPS-stimulated cells. Western blot results showed that 6-MC treatment decreased the protein levels of iNOS and COX-2 induced by LPS, while mechanistic studies revealed its inhibitory effects on the MAPK and NF-kappa B pathways.

Review Medicine, Research & Experimental

A fresh look at the role of spiramycin in preventing a neglected disease: meta-analyses of observational studies

Jose G. Montoya et al.

Summary: The meta-analysis of 33 studies showed a significant reduction in mother-to-child transmission rates of Toxoplasma gondii following spiramycin treatment in pregnant women.
